Transaction 2ebbec5a32947cb5826b91c146fcd3732ca60a2bd843ab33afcf661c5ce56d43

1 Input
2 Outputs
  • 2ebbec5a32947cb5826b91c146fcd3732ca60a2bd843ab33afcf661c5ce56d43:0
  • value  900683
    address  3DdQrwNR5xhdNKFLBkrfN8qun2HHhdC2mr
  • 2ebbec5a32947cb5826b91c146fcd3732ca60a2bd843ab33afcf661c5ce56d43:1
  • value  87446154
    address  17qvn6d998ekLuYDZLFAfSY3Kq4vjS2uY5